Designed for professional environments where equipment is accessed frequently and organization matters, this pair of split rack rails provides robust support and easy access across a full 70-inch span. Built to fit Middle Atlantic’s GRK Series racks, the 40‑RU capacity enables you to maximize space while keeping gear neatly arranged, secure, and ready for quick servicing. The 10-32 mounting hardware and the 12-24 style rail system deliver a reliable, industry‑standard solution for AV, IT, and audio installations. Whether you are outfitting a broadcast rack, a recording studio, or a data center enclosure, these rails balance strength, precision alignment, and clean aesthetics to reduce clutter and improve workflow.

  • GRK Series compatibility: Specifically engineered to fit Middle Atlantic GRK series racks, ensuring a precise fit and reliable performance in rack enclosures designed for professional-grade equipment education and deployment.
  • 40 RU capacity across a 70-inch span: Pair of rails provides ample mounting space for a wide range of equipment, enabling scalable configurations from compact gear to larger multi‑unit racks while maintaining accessible front and back access.
  • 12-24 style rack rails: Utilizes a standard 12-24 rack spacing system, making it easy to align with existing equipment and accessories while ensuring consistent mounting holes and compatibility with common rack devices.
  • 10-32 mounting screws: The rails are designed for 10-32 hardware, a common industry spec that simplifies hardware sourcing and guarantees secure attachment for heavy or sensitive equipment.
  • Split rail design for flexible maintenance: The split configuration allows quick removal or access to devices and cables, reducing downtime during installs, swaps, and routine servicing while keeping the overall rack footprint clean and organized.

How to install Middle Atlantic Split Rackrail

Installing these split rack rails is a straightforward process designed to minimize downtime and maximize reliability in professional installations. Before you begin, confirm that you have GRK series racks and the appropriate 10-32 mounting hardware. A clean workspace, a measuring tape, and a basic set of screwdrivers will help ensure a precise and secure installation.

  • Plan your layout: Determine the desired front-to-back placement on your GRK rack and confirm the rails will cover a 70-inch span when paired. If you’re mounting multiple rack units, map out the RU positions to ensure even distribution and accessibility.
  • Prepare the rails: Unpack the split rack rails and identify the two halves. Inspect the mounting holes for alignment with the GRK rack’s vertical rails. Have the 10-32 mounting screws ready, along with washers if included.
  • Align with rack channels: Position the rails so that the mounting holes line up with the GRK rack’s front and rear rails. Start with the upper rail first to establish a reference point; ensure the rail halves are parallel and level to prevent device misalignment.
  • Attach the rails: Secure the rails to the rack using the 10-32 screws, inserting from the outside edge toward the interior. Tighten gradually in a cross‑pattern to maintain even pressure and prevent warping. If the rails include a rear mounting option, repeat the process there to reinforce stability.
  • Check clearance and test: With the rails mounted, verify that there is adequate clearance for devices, cabling, and any slide-out shelves or trays you may use. Insert a sample device or test panel to confirm alignment, then slide in and out to ensure smooth operation and that cables do not bind.
  • Finalize and organize: Once confirmed, label RU sections if needed and route cables neatly behind the rails. Consider adding cable management accessories to maintain a clutter-free, professional rack appearance.
